Apex NC Real Estate >>YMCA Breaks Ground In Apex

Oct. 18, 2006
Categorized in: Community Details

For those of you who love working out in Cary at the YMCA and have been waiting for years for the new YMCA your day is almost here.  The YMCA of the Triangle enters an exciting new eara with the groundbreaking of the Southwest Wake YMCA.  Volunteers and community leaders gathered at the property at 8951 Holly Springs Road in Apex on Tuesday. 

The main building will be nearly 45,000 square feet and will include an indoor track,gymnasium, wellness center and nursery.  Other amenities include steam and sauna rooms for men and women.  The new YMCA will have a variety of popular programs similar to the other YMCAs in the area like after school, track-out programs and summer day camps. 

In addition to the new amenities, the YMCA will have a big impact on the local economy.  The YMCA will employ over 800 people and operate with a $7.5 Milion dollar annual budget.
